Health-Related Quality of Life for TRICARE Beneficiaries (November 2021)
In this brief, we examine trends and relationships with Health-Related Quality of Life (HRQOL) in TRICARE beneficiaries. We used the CDC’s HRQOL-4 tool, which includes questions about general health, the number of physically and mentally unhealthy days in the last 30 days, and functional impairment.
